首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何设计好RESTful API

,但是不能快速从接口 URL 定义中明确该接口含义,需要进一步读代码确认 URL中英文单词使用五花八门,搜索某个接口不知道具体关键字 请求方法动词如 POST GET 随意使用 完成当前业务接口对接...,前端人员经常会询问下一步业务流程接口定义在哪里,对接形式是什么样 以上只是前后端人员通过接口交互一小部分问题,这些问题就好比"牙痛",不致命,但是在整个软件开发生命周期内,天天"牙痛”是很要命...了解到以上内容, 那REST 世界"交通灯"规则是什么样?...我们来了解一下 如何设计和开发一个高可用 REST APIs 网上一直有关于"最好Restful API设计"争论,何为最好,至今没有一个官方指导。...,没有杂乱动词在 URL 中,大家理解含义相同 URL 层级 现实中哪有这么简单 CRUD,资源相互关联与嵌套很常见,查找 id 是 12 用户所有帖子, 如何设计这个 URL,下面两种设计也会有争论

1.6K20

服务器优势在哪里

传统服务器是具有独立CPU、内存条、硬盘,存储数据安全性不高,硬盘浪费率比较高,企业一旦扩张业务,原有的服务器资源不够,又得购置新服务器,而且物理服务器还存在老化、损坏、维护等方面的问题,这样造成成本加剧及时间耽误...而服务器可以弥补这种不足,不仅如此,计算还有一些其他方面的优势: 1、从技术方面来讲   服务器使用了计算技术,而计算技术,整合了计算、网络、存储等各种软件和硬件技术,将这些资源进行合理整合...传统服务器,就是独立了,不能整合这些资源。 2、从安全性方面来讲   服务器具有天然防ARP攻击和MAC欺骗,快照备份,数据永久不丢失,保证数据安全。而传统服务器则不具有这方面的功能。...3、从可靠性来讲   服务器是基于服务器集群,因此硬件冗余度较高,故障率低;而传统服务器则相对来说硬件冗余较少,故障率较高。...5、从成本方面来讲   主机一般是按需付费,可弹性拓展,无需购买物理服务器,无需设置机房,更不需要定期维护、维修等,不仅可以节约基础设施成本。还节省了IT运维成本。

15.1K70
您找到你想要的搜索结果了吗?
是的
没有找到

搭建私有平台优势在哪里

私有就像私家车,只有自己用。私有特点就是在企业内部部署,不使用第三方平台辅助。有保密性高,安全性高,个性化私有定制特点。那么如何搭建私有平台呢? 什么是私有?...私有计算相应为企业提供了众多优势(包括自助服务、伸缩性和弹性),通过专用资源提供额外控制和定制能力,远远优于当地管理计算基础结构。 私有配图4.jpg 私有优势体现在哪里?...私有往往会在防火墙后面,而不是放在某个数据中心内。所以公司员工访问基于私有应用程序时,网络应该非常稳定,不会受到不稳定影响。...私有平台和公有这两种形式平台都是可扩展、灵活计算能力集群,通常是服务器包括管理在内相关服务。公有容易访问,通常由亚马逊、谷歌、微软等大公司提供。...另一方面,私有仅供特定机构使用,可由idc数据中心服务器托管,使用自己设备和位置,或者经常由私有第三方提供商管理,确保更新、服务质量和安全性。 私有配图3.jpg

11.2K30

如何设计好接口(Google分享)

一、好接口特性 (1)易学 (2)易用,甚至不需要文档 (3)难于误用 (4)容易阅读与维护 (5)容易扩展 二、接口设计实现过程 (1)分析需求 考虑是否有更佳解决方案?...这是否使我们这真想要需求?...(5)注意“正常”异常维护 你接口是为了满足所有需求?...即使有异常,也不要紧 三、接口设计基本原则 (1)只做并做好一件事 函数名自解释; 不恰当函数名,往往是不恰当设计征兆 (2)如果没做到(1),就将函数分解 只增加,永远不要删除函数与接口 你永远不知道这个接口被谁在使用...能不用string尽量不用 使用float地方尽量用double,64bit (7)不改变参数使用const (8)参数个数不宜太多 如果过多,就要考虑接口合理性了 (9)避免返回值与异常同时返回

90760

哪里有轻量小巧mac笔记软件?

哪里有轻量小巧mac笔记软件?Pendo for Mac是一款运行在Mac平台上一款新颖精美的mac笔记软件。 ...测试环境:MacOS 10.15.2 mac笔记软件主要功能 1、智能日程 PendoIQ足够理解文字内容里复杂计划安排,时间,地点和重复信息。...5、时间轴排布 所有操作过痕迹,无论是一个小笔记,一个开会日程,还是一个超市买水果待办单子,都会留在Pendo里,成为你记忆一部分,这些不得不做,或是无心之作小事,才是我们人生经历里最宝贵,最值得回忆小幸福...可以打开时间轴上任意内容,比如你日记或笔记,再定义它一次,让它变成朋友圈发出去。 全Pendo搜索让你日记、笔记、日程及发过朋友圈都触手可寻。...细节、细节、更多细节:举例说明 - 写好待办用微信发给朋友,对方只要复制粘贴到她Pendo里,就会自动识别为待办;划掉待办会掉到列表底端,未完成项任务一目了然 - 问问身边用过Pendo朋友你就会知道

3.1K30

以后,SaaS化RPA未来在哪里?

就在上个月,来也科技还发布了《RPA上白皮书》报告,向行业内外系统介绍RPA上各种情况。 整个行业,都意识到了RPA上好处。...未来出路又在哪里01 RPA为什么要上王吉伟频道认为,RPA之所以要上,有以下几个业态发展必然因素。 一是,RPA业务发展所需。每个RPA产品都会往平台化发展,平台化必然要上。...但是,以上这几种情况,都不能算是真正RPA上。什么是真正RPA上呢?...这个定义,很好阐述了RPA上本质。也就是说,RPA上并不是部分业务上,而是将整个RPA运营流程全部迁移上。 上RPA,可以更好助力企业增效降本。...至于计算厂商推出RPA就更不用说,它们是搭载于计算上应用,本身就具备SaaS属性。

2K10

国内计算下半场机遇在哪里

关于计算下半场,以阿里为代表互联网巨头大家已经谈论得很多,本文将从2022年逆势增长「运营商」切入,从另一个角度理解计算新战局。...作为曾经离计算最近行业,托管IDC业务运营商很早就发现了计算市场,可以说是最早进行计算战略布局。...重资产投入、高技术应用公有领域,聚集效应明显,市场逐渐由超大规模提供商主导,头部亚马逊AWS、谷歌GCP、微软Azure、IBM 占全球使用量61%以上,亚马逊AWS成为全球最受欢迎商...根据2020年IDC进行调研,73%受访企业认为原生技术部署与运行环境从单一环境向混合、多云环境演进。...而如今在政策、产业需求等带来新变化下,运营商与互联网厂商走向了不可避免竞争关系,互联网迎来了战略转型关键时期。 互联网往上走,往产业、行业走成为了新变化。

2.5K20

后端思想篇:设计好接口36个锦囊!

后面打算出一个后端思想技术专栏,主要包括后端一些设计、或者后端规范相关,希望对大家日常工作有帮助哈。 我们做后端开发工程师,主要工作就是:如何把一个接口设计好。...所以,今天就给大家介绍,设计好接口36个锦囊。本文就是后端思想专栏第一篇哈。 1. 接口参数校验 入参出参校验是每个程序员必备基本素养。你设计接口,必须先校验参数。...堵住A请求会消耗占用系统线程、IO等资源。当请求A服务越来越多,占用计算机资源也越来越多,最终会导致系统瓶颈出现,造成其他请求同样不可用,最后导致业务系统崩溃。...是指系统在面临高并发,或者大流量请求情况下,限制新请求对系统访问,从而保证系统稳定性。...简单来说,分布式事务指就是分布式系统中事务,它存在就是为了保证不同数据库节点数据一致性。

48720

数据隐私:将密钥放在哪里?

假设你正要外出,却发现钥匙找不到了,家人可能会问你第一件事是,“上一次看到钥匙时记得在哪里?”在工作中,要求使用计算密钥(确保数据私密性密钥)可能会有不同反应,有些人有可能对此一无所知。...根据IDG公司一项调查,许多迁移到公有企业已经通过将一些工作负载遣返回内部部署设施来扭转了局面,部分原因是管理和数据集成复杂程度。那么,如何确保良好迁移,从而确保数据隐私和平稳过渡呢?...他们通常需要访问控制以及数据和密钥保管。简单地说,必须知道密钥在哪里。 良好计算数据安全性是什么样? 但是,如何保护企业在多云过渡中管理密钥呢?...但是,如果使用是多云设置,则希望能够跨服务进行集中化,并利用其他相关工具。 由于服务对企业战略价值,因此对服务整体使用已经引起人们对在一个或多个公有云中存储敏感数据强烈关注。...保护数据隐私是谁工作? 回答这个问题核心概念是分担责任模型。它定义了计算服务商(CSP)与客户之间分工界限,以保护服务。

2.7K10

计好数字数目(快速幂)

题目 我们称一个数字字符串是 好数字 当它满足(下标从 0 开始)偶数 下标处数字为 偶数 且 奇数 下标处数字为 质数 (2,3,5 或 7)。...比方说,“2582” 是好数字,因为偶数下标处数字(2 和 8)是偶数且奇数下标处数字(5 和 2)为质数。 但 “3245” 不是 好数字,因为 3 在偶数下标处但不是偶数。...给你一个整数 n ,请你返回长度为 n 且为好数字数字字符串 总数 。 由于答案可能会很大,请你将它对 10^9 + 7 取余后返回 。...一个 数字字符串 是每一位都由 0 到 9 组成字符串,且可能包含前导 0 。 示例 1: 输入:n = 1 输出:5 解释:长度为 1 好数字包括 "0","2","4","6","8" 。...博客地址 https://michael.blog.csdn.net/ 长按或扫码关注我公众号(Michael阿明),一起加油、一起学习进步!

23020

你所知道计算定义出自哪里

NIST(美国国家标准及技术研究所)对计算定义,大概是到目前为止最被广泛认同定义。 ?...部署模型 私有计算基础架构提供给包含多个消费者单一组织专门使用。该计算基础架构可以由该组织、第三方机构或他们组合来拥有、管理和运营,基础架构可以位于组织内部或外部。...社区 - 计算基础架构提供给一个由多个组织成员组成消费者社区专门使用,这些组织有共同关注的话题(例如,任务、安全需求、政策、合规性考量)。...公有 - 计算基础架构提供给公众开放使用,该计算基础架构可以由商业机构、学术组织或政府机关、或者他们组合来拥有、管理和运营,基础架构位于计算服务提供商内部。...混合 – 由两个或多个独立不同计算基础架构(私有、社区或公有)组成,他们通过标准或私有技术被绑定在一起,实现数据和应用程序可移植性(例如,当爆发时实现多云之间负载均衡)。

5.4K70

qt 如何设计好布局和漂亮界面。

刚接触时候,你是否考虑过软件大小随意变化问题,你是否考虑过后期添加组件,随着我们软件越来越庞大,让组件自动分配空间显尤为重要。 ​       ...部件可以利用额外空间,因此它将会得到尽可能多空间(例如:水平方向上滑块)。...Maximum:控件sizeHint为控件最大尺寸,控件不能放大,但是可以缩小到它最小允许尺寸。 ?Preferred:控件sizeHint是它sizeHint,但是可以放大或者缩小。 ?...这时候,你可能要问这里布局和刚才布局一样吗,是一样,在不过在这里,可以更快速对组件进行布局,比如下面这样: ? ?...*/ /*该语句意思是将QPshButton类按钮中字体设置为红色。

8.4K41

如何正确选择数据库 数据库在哪里购买

当我们在选择数据库时候,需要考虑方面有很多,因为数据库有着不同类别,大家在选择时候一定要根据实际需求,这样才能够让工作变得更加高效,以下就是关于如何正确选择数据库相关内容。...如何正确选择数据库 很多企业都会使用数据库,如何正确选择数据库?首先大家需要关注它地区和可用区,这对于使用数据库来说是非常重要。...数据库在哪里购买 网络上数据库非常多,因为现在网络技术已经越来越成熟了,但数据库并不是免费使用,它相当于是一种无形资产,需要购买后才能够正常使用。...一般来说,大家如果想要购买数据库,可以在腾讯进行购买,里面有些不同类型数据库,大家可以根据自己需求来进行选择。除此之外,在腾讯官网之中,还有专门客服人员帮助大家解疑答惑。...以上就是关于如何正确选择数据库详细内容,如果大家要使用数据库,就可以按照自己需求来选择,而且现在可以直接在相应官网中购买数据库,所以使用数据库是比较简单,如果想要了解更多内容,可以直接进入官网

8.6K30

哪里有公司硬盘好用?腾讯硬盘有哪些优点?

硬盘是一种高性能产品,不少公司都拥有属于自己硬盘,但是在硬盘选择方面应当谨慎小心,如果选择了质量不佳硬盘产品,有可能导致公司重要信息被泄露,所以很多人都不知道哪里有公司硬盘好用,下面为大家介绍哪里有公司硬盘好用...哪里有公司硬盘好用 腾讯硬盘是一款专业企业存储系统,能够为企业提供海量数据储存服务,帮助企业实现文件,快捷分享文件,数据备份和集中管理等多种多样功能,而且其拥有一定技术优势,在国内用户已经超过了大部分公司用户量...腾讯硬盘有哪些优点 1、腾讯硬盘可以为企业打造专业私有服务,在这里企业不必担心数据泄露问题,还能够对文件进行统一管理,对于大部分公司来说,腾讯都具备高可靠性优势。...2、腾讯硬盘能够提高企业管理效率,节约企业管理成本,并帮助企业实现个性化移动办公。...以上为大家介绍了哪里有公司硬盘好用,如果公司需要选择一款民用牌作为办公工具的话,不妨考虑腾讯硬盘,这款硬盘相对于其他硬盘来说,拥有诸多优势是一款性能非常不错工具。

13.3K20

ArcGIS中使用带图号地图

摘要: 政府部门提供图号标准地图是正式用图时必备地图(尤其涉及国界)。...各地民政部门网站-行政区划 民政部网站-全国行政区划信息查询平台: http://202.108.98.30/map 提供行政区划图(带图号)、县级以上区划历史变更情况、人口、地域面积等信息 (IE浏览器右键图片可将行政区划图保存为...并在图题下注明“注:该图基于自然资源部标准地图服务网站下载图号为GS(2016)xxxx号标准地图制作,底图无修改。”...,即可 ② ArcGIS中使用该坐标,先导出一个相应行政区划数据(参考数据),到CAD(是的,用现有数据去校准我们图号、或者更详细数据) ③ 将上一步AI导出文件导入到CAD,并复制到参考数据...,还请有谁制作了,分享一个shp文件(标注图号/出处),到“行政区划&标准地图”文件夹下面(网页打开,建个文件夹,然后直接拖过去),替大伙感谢你 还记得小节底下成语接龙吗?

10.6K122

腾讯域名证书哪里下载_备案域名证书获取方法

在腾讯给域名备案时候,需要提供域名证书,对于才开始学习自己建网站朋友来说,可能会有一个问题就是:域名证书从哪里找?域名证书从哪里下载?...这里奶爸建站笔记就给大家介绍下在腾讯注册域名或者其他国内域名注册商注册域名从哪里获取域名证书。 腾讯域名证书获取方式 如果你是从腾讯注册域名,那么域名证书从哪里找呢?...首先,登录腾讯控制面板,然后在页面商找到域名管理(如果你域名不是在腾讯注册,那么域名管理是空,看文章后面的其他地方域名证书获取方式) 进入域名管理后,在你需要生成域名证书域名末尾,点击更多...其他域名注册商域名证书下载方式 如果你域名不是在腾讯购买,是在阿里,或者其他国内网站购买,那么你进入你域名详情页面,一般也可以找得到域名证书下载地址,如果找不到的话可以联系客服或者帮助中心搜索...最早时候,例如godaddy这些地方注册域名证书只能自己用软件生成,官方是不提供。 域名证书有什么用? 知道从哪里下载和生成域名证书后,可能你还会问域名证书有什么用?

66.6K00

上传文件到服务器硬盘路径 服务器优势在哪里

在实际使用服务器过程中,用户们经常会将文件上传到服务器硬盘上,在使用过程中,可能就会涉及到上传文件到服务器硬盘路径问题。...上传文件到服务器硬盘路径 关于上传文件到服务器硬盘路径问题,其实方法是很多,操作起来也比较简单。...,这个时候只要把自己需要上传到服务器文件进行复制就可以了。...服务器优势在哪里 在了解了关于上传文件到服务器硬盘路径问题之后,还需要对服务器有一个概念,以及服务器优势。其实,服务器与传统服务器对比,还是具有相当多优势和特点。...比如云服务器体系架构是包含了处理器模块、存储模块、网络处理模块等,这种架构形式就会大大提高了利用率,同时在系统之中也节省了许多重复硬件。

13.3K30

未来将迈向哪里?计算产业发展道路回顾

计算行业发展到现在可谓是经历了很多起伏,在这近8年发展时段里不管是国内计算市场,还是国外市场,已经开始有越来越多企业在公有云和混合之间展开激烈竞争。...近两年来,中国计算市场进入高速增长期,与移动互联网、互联网等快速发展可以说是密不可分。众多移动应用开发者为了用最短时间争夺市场,以最稳定服务赢得并留住客户,服务便成了其最优之选。...未来三四年间将是计算企业打拼关键时期,各企业应尽快在计算产业链中找到自己明确定位和战略方向。...那么作为计算基础设施服务提供商那些企业又该如何找准自己位置,目前从整体来看,计算在整个IT行业当中还存在很大争议和质疑。...当今计算在很多行业当中都已经开展了更为深入应用,对于企业而言,如何利用计算技术和平台更好扩充企业规模,提升企业办公效率是非常重要

1.1K70

腾讯服务器最多挂几块硬盘 服务器优势在哪里

在许多互联网平台以及大型企业网站都开始使用服务器。服务器比起一般传统服务器拥有许多优点,在服务器性能以及所提供服务上面更加先进,因此服务器也成为了许多企业网站首选。...许多大型品牌运营服务器都可以提供不同性能不同体积以及不同内存和不同价位服务器。腾讯服务器最多挂几块硬盘呢? 腾讯服务器最多挂几块硬盘? 现在来看一看腾讯服务器最多挂几块硬盘。...腾讯服务器针对不同企业网站需求提供了多项个性化选择,挂载硬盘是服务器必备项目之一。...服务器优势在哪里? 前面了解了腾讯服务器最多挂几块硬盘,现在服务器如此流行服务器优势在哪里呢?...随着计算技术普及,在未来必定会有更多网站和企业,选择使用服务器以及相关服务。

19.5K20

商业化增长之路:如何设计好抽奖

|导语 抽奖玩法对用户来说有着很大吸引力,因为存在一种以小博大可能,用户可以通过该类玩法获得高于投入收益,对于付费渗透,ARPU等方面有着显著提升效果。...,仍然需要付费;这个方法同样没有心理负担,用户可以对于产出较低结果选择不付费,只对产出较高结果付费; 相较于第一种方法,先抽后付做法优势是一来用户是经过付费培养,后续心理门槛相对较低,二来毕竟用户也有一定付费投入...FIFA中抽卡玩法,每年贡献利润占整个母公司EA25%) 2.2 为用户创造建立投注方法论环境 沉迷于抽奖玩法用户,往往坚信自己掌握了一套方法论。...(图片来源:腾讯NOW直播) 结尾 抽奖玩法作为商业化变现一个经典模式,现在已经逐渐衍生出很多各种各样套路,对于这个玩法研究可以更好实现商业化快速增长。 ? ? 快手另类抉择 ?...腾讯敏捷研发之战 ? 腾讯API3.0网关探索与思考 ?

1.2K22
领券